The main duties of a Taylor County Prosecuting Attorney are typically imposed by law. This includes taking on behalf of the State at all trials related to violations that took place within the district attorney's geographic jurisdiction.
Taylor County Prosecuting Attorney generally charge the accused with crimes via information or grand indictments by juries. After levying criminal charges Taylor County Prosecuting Attorney will investigate those accused of the crime.
Taylor County Prosecuting Attorney often also have obligations that aren't connected with criminal prosecution. This includes protecting the county from civil lawsuits sometimes, and even initiating actions for the county, as well as preparing and review contracts that are signed by the county, and offering legal advice and guidance to local authorities. In certain jurisdictions the county attorney may not have any involvement in criminal cases in any way, and serves only as the attorney of the county.
Taylor County Prosecuting Attorney are assigned to specialized units created to tackle corruption in the public sector as well as organized crime, violence in the family and hate crimes, elderly abuse, fraud on consumers and other serious crimes.
